Martina is a first-year medical student at Sidney Kimmel Medical College in Philadelphia. She is originally from Brescia, Italy. After finishing high school, she moved to Los Angeles where she attended UCLA and graduated with a B.S. in Molecular, Cell, and Developmental Biology. During her time in college, she was the co-founder of a neurology research student group at Ronald Reagan Medical Center, volunteered as a tutor in underserved communities, and was involved in neurology and cancer research. After graduation she took a gap year to conduct basic science cancer research at UCSF before enrolling in medical school. Talk to Martina about planning for medical school as an international student, research, gap years, standardized tests, and the medical school application process!
